I was really excited for it to come out and bought all the hype. Built a monster of a computer that could handle anything just for this and now... I could care less.
After seeing over 70 hours of beautiful vistas and the awesome ocean graphics and hearing a great sound track I realized that I'm just not invested in the story or the characters. I know that I could have skipped a lot and just stayed with the story line but I'm not wired that way in gaming I guess. I like to turn over every stone and either craft or loot the best equipment out there so I can intimidate the biggest baddest bosses out there. The times between story based content are terrible when played this way leaving no real reason for me to be concerned when I accomplish anything.
Maybe it's just that I play in a more linear fashion than the game was designed for, I don't know for sure but I have realized that I would rather play the preceding DA titles or ME titles than sludge through DA:I which, for me, is just really boring.
The combat is too easy once you figure it out, the crafting is meh, the terrain is such that I have often said screw it as I took a third trip around a mountain trying to get somewhere only to find out later that you have to do a quest or something to open up the territory. I hate the interface for the PC, I miss not controlling my attributes and detest having to search for a ping then walking over and practically standing on top of an object to trigger a 3 second animation to pop up a menu letting me click on what I want.
I feel as if I ordered a 12 year old scotch and was given a glass of muddy water.
There are a lot of people that are loving this game and I'm glad they are and wish them well. But for me, this is not the game I was led to believe was going to be delivered.
